Major Ecosystems in India
India’s vast geographical expanse encompasses a variety of ecosystems, each with distinct characteristics and ecological functions. The major ecosystems include:
Forests
Forests cover approximately 21% of India’s land area and are categorized into tropical rainforests, moist deciduous forests, dry deciduous forests, thorn forests, and alpine forests. The Western Ghats and the northeastern states boast dense tropical rainforests that serve as hotspots of biodiversity. These forests are home to iconic species such as the Bengal tiger, Indian elephant, and numerous endemic birds and plants. In contrast, dry deciduous forests dominate central India, supporting species adapted to seasonal drought.
Grasslands
Grasslands in India, though often overlooked, constitute vital ecosystems supporting a variety of herbivores, birds, and insects. The Terai-Duar grasslands at the foothills of the Himalayas and the high-altitude alpine meadows are significant for migratory birds and rare mammals like the Tibetan antelope. Grasslands also act as important carbon sinks and help maintain soil health in many regions.
Wetlands
India’s wetlands, ranging from freshwater lakes and rivers to coastal estuaries and mangrove swamps, are crucial for biodiversity and human society. The Chilika Lake in Odisha—the largest brackish water lagoon in Asia—and the Sundarbans mangrove forests in West Bengal are prime examples. Wetlands serve as breeding grounds for fish and migratory birds, regulate water cycles, and protect coastal areas from erosion and storms.
Deserts
The Thar Desert in Rajasthan is India's primary desert ecosystem. Despite its harsh environment, it supports a variety of specially adapted plants and animals such as the Indian gazelle (chinkara), desert fox, and unique reptile species. The desert’s sparse vegetation and sand dunes form fragile ecosystems that are increasingly threatened by human encroachment.
Coastal and Marine Ecosystems
India’s coastline stretches over 7,500 kilometers, encompassing diverse coastal ecosystems including sandy beaches, rocky shores, coral reefs, and mangroves. These areas support fisheries, tourism, and harbor rich marine biodiversity including endangered species such as the Olive Ridley sea turtle and the dugong. Coral reefs, like those in the Gulf of Mannar and Lakshadweep, are vital for marine life but face threats from bleaching and pollution.
Regional Biodiversity Hotspots
India is recognized globally for its biodiversity hotspots—regions that harbor exceptional levels of species richness and endemism but are also under severe threat. These hotspots are priority areas for conservation due to their ecological significance and vulnerability.
The Western Ghats
The Western Ghats mountain range stretches along the western coast of India and is one of the world’s eight "hottest" biodiversity hotspots. This region is characterized by tropical rainforests, montane forests, and shola grasslands. It is home to over 7,400 species of plants, many of which are endemic, alongside diverse amphibians, birds, and mammals including the Nilgiri tahr and Lion-tailed macaque. The Western Ghats also play a crucial role in regulating the monsoon climate of peninsular India.
The Himalayas
The Himalayan region, spanning the northern borders of India, is a biodiversity treasure trove with altitudinal gradients creating varied habitats from subtropical forests to alpine meadows and glaciers. This area supports rare and endangered species such as the snow leopard, red panda, and Himalayan musk deer. The Himalayas are also critically important for their role in water security, feeding some of the largest river systems in Asia.
Indo-Bangladesh Region and Brahmaputra Valley
The Indo-Bangladesh region, especially the Brahmaputra valley and the Sundarbans mangrove forest, represent another vital biodiversity hotspot. The Sundarbans is the largest mangrove forest in the world and a UNESCO World Heritage Site, sheltering the elusive Royal Bengal tiger, estuarine crocodiles, and a rich variety of fish and bird species. This region also supports complex human-nature interactions, with local communities depending on forest resources and fisheries.
Other Notable Hotspots
- Indo-Burma Region: Encompassing Northeast India, this hotspot is noted for its diverse flora and fauna, including many endemic orchids and amphibians.
- Hills of Northeast India: These hills serve as a crucial ecological corridor and harbor many rare bird species, such as the hornbill.
Indigenous Knowledge and Cultural Practices in Biodiversity Conservation
India’s indigenous communities have traditionally lived in close harmony with nature, developing sustainable practices that contribute significantly to biodiversity conservation. Their understanding of local ecosystems, medicinal plants, and wildlife behavior has been passed down through generations, often embedded in cultural and religious practices.
For example, sacred groves—patches of forest conserved for religious reasons—are found across India and act as biodiversity reservoirs. These groves protect rare species and serve as genetic banks for future generations. Similarly, traditional agroforestry and mixed cropping systems practiced by tribal communities help maintain soil fertility and reduce pest outbreaks without chemical inputs.
Such indigenous knowledge is increasingly recognized as vital for modern conservation strategies, emphasizing the need for community participation and respect for traditional rights in ecosystem management.
Conservation Challenges
Despite India’s rich biodiversity, multiple threats jeopardize the survival of its indigenous ecosystems. The rapid pace of industrialization, urban expansion, and agricultural intensification have led to significant habitat loss and fragmentation. Key challenges include:
- Deforestation: Illegal logging and land conversion for agriculture and infrastructure have diminished forest cover, impacting species dependent on these habitats.
- Habitat Fragmentation: Fragmented habitats reduce genetic diversity and increase vulnerability to environmental changes and human-wildlife conflict.
- Pollution: Industrial effluents, pesticide runoff, and plastic waste degrade water bodies and soil, affecting both terrestrial and aquatic ecosystems.
- Climate Change: Altered rainfall patterns, rising temperatures, and extreme weather events disrupt ecosystems, affecting species distribution and phenology.
- Invasive Species: Non-native plants and animals outcompete indigenous species, leading to biodiversity loss.
Human-Wildlife Conflict
As human populations expand into wildlife habitats, conflicts have increased, particularly in regions adjoining forests and protected areas. Crop damage, livestock predation, and occasional attacks on humans have led to retaliatory killings of wildlife. Addressing these conflicts requires integrated approaches combining habitat restoration, community awareness, and compensation schemes.
Illegal Wildlife Trade
Poaching and illegal trade in wildlife products remain significant threats to many endangered species, including tigers, pangolins, and medicinal plants. Strengthening enforcement and international cooperation is critical to combat these activities.
Strategies for Ecosystem Conservation and Sustainable Management
Recognizing the importance of conserving indigenous ecosystems, India has developed comprehensive policies and programs aimed at protecting biodiversity and promoting sustainable use of natural resources.
Protected Areas and National Parks
India has established a network of over 100 national parks, wildlife sanctuaries, and biosphere reserves covering around 5% of its land area. These protected areas serve as refuges for threatened species and preserve critical habitats. Examples include Jim Corbett National Park, Kaziranga National Park, and the Nilgiri Biosphere Reserve. Efforts are underway to improve connectivity between fragmented habitats through wildlife corridors.
Community-Based Conservation
Engaging local communities as stakeholders in conservation has proven to be effective. Joint Forest Management (JFM) initiatives empower villagers to manage and protect forests sustainably. Additionally, community reserves and conservation areas managed by indigenous groups help safeguard biodiversity while supporting traditional livelihoods.
Legislation and Policies
India’s key legal frameworks include the Wildlife Protection Act (1972), Forest Conservation Act (1980), and the Biological Diversity Act (2002). These laws regulate hunting, forest use, and promote biodiversity conservation. The National Biodiversity Action Plan outlines strategies to conserve habitats and species while integrating conservation with development goals.
Restoration Projects
Reforestation, wetland restoration, and mangrove afforestation programs have been implemented to restore degraded ecosystems. The Green India Mission, part of India’s National Action Plan on Climate Change, aims to increase forest cover and improve ecosystem services. Mangrove restoration along the eastern and western coasts enhances coastal protection and supports fisheries.
Scientific Research and Monitoring
Ongoing research on species ecology, habitat requirements, and climate impacts informs conservation planning. Technologies such as remote sensing, GIS mapping, and camera traps help monitor wildlife populations and habitat changes in real time.
Awareness and Education
Environmental education programs target schools, communities, and policymakers to foster a culture of conservation. Celebrating biodiversity-related events and involving citizens in activities like tree planting and wildlife surveys raise public commitment to protecting ecosystems.
